Registered Nurse (RN) OpportunityWe are seeking a dedicated and compassionate Registered Nurse (RN) to join our exceptional healthcare team. As an RN, you will play a vital role in delivering outstanding nursing care to our residents, helping ensure their physical, emotional, and social well‑being. Working alongside a skilled interdisciplinary team, you will make a meaningful impact every day while building rewarding relationships with residents and their families.
Key Responsibilities- Deliver patient‑centered nursing care as a key member of our RN team
- Monitor residents’ conditions, perform assessments, and document changes accurately
- Administer medications and treatments in accordance with physician orders and RN protocols
- Collaborate with physicians, therapists, and other Registered Nurses and healthcare professionals to implement individualized care plans
- Educate residents and families on health conditions and care plans
- Maintain up‑to‑date and compliant RN documentation in electronic medical records (EMR)
- Ensure a safe, clean, and therapeutic environment for all residents
- Supervise and support Certified Nursing Assistants (CNAs) and other direct care staff
- Active Registered Nurse (RN) license in the state you wish to work
- New grads encouraged to apply!
- Experience in geriatric care, long‑term care, or rehabilitation nursing strongly preferred
- Solid understanding of clinical protocols and state/federal regulations
- Strong communication, documentation, and collaboration skills
- Passionate, empathetic, and committed to delivering resident‑first care
- BLS/CPR certification required (ACLS a plus)
